Public transport

The easiest bus, tube and train station to get to for visiting London central and other places.
This is a tube station on district line. You can catch direct trains to Earls Court and be there in less than 20 mins and from there with Piccadilly Line it’s only 20 mins to Soho or London West End or Oxford Street. Easy access and this tune station also has a lift if you have a buggy. Also you can also catch Piccadilly line from Earls Court to go to Heathrow Terminal 123 & 5 very easy.

Public transport

If you wish to go to Waterloo station (Waterloo is the closest public transport station to London Eye) from this bus stop you can get buses to Earlsfield Bus Stop D to Victoria, Waterloo and Tooting Broadway. Buses run very regularly. At Waterloo station you can change to underground (Jubilee and Northern lines) and Waterloo is only two stops on Jubilee line away from London Bridge Station (to see Tower of London). Waterloo station also worth the visit as it has appeared in many films including The Bourne Supremacy.
